Overview

Cartalax, also known as AED or T-31 peptide, is a synthetic peptide derived from the amino acid sequence of the alpha-1 chain of type XI collagen (Alanine–Glutamate–Aspartate). It has also been isolated from kidney extracts containing polypeptides. Classified among the Khavinson peptides, Cartalax has been investigated for its potential as a bioregulator, with research focusing on inflammation, cartilage repair, and possible roles in cellular aging.

Research Background

Peptides like Cartalax are studied for their potential influence on biological processes connected to osteoarthritis, fibroblast longevity, and tissue regeneration. Experimental findings suggest Cartalax may play a role in supporting fibroblast proliferation, reducing apoptosis, and modulating markers associated with aging and regeneration.

Mechanism of Interest

  • Cell proliferation: Suggested to enhance expression of Ki-67, a marker of cellular division, potentially extending fibroblast lifespan.
  • Cell regeneration: May increase CD98hc expression, a protein linked to cell vitality and repair processes.
  • Anti-apoptotic action: Research indicates possible suppression of caspase-3 activity, which could reduce programmed cell death.
  • Cartilage and tissue repair: Investigated for potential modulatory effects relevant to osteoarthritis and connective tissue health.

Molecular Information

  • Molecular Formula: C12H19N3O8
  • Molecular Weight: 333.29 g/mol
  • Sequence: Ala–Glu–Asp
  • Other Names: AED, T-31, SCHEMBL5324601
